Baked capsicum with paneer and broccoli

This dish is full of colors, less oil, and less spices . It’s full of nutrients and it’s healthy too. Can have with dal +rice or simply with a bowl of soup which will keep you full for a longer period. Good for people who are on weight loss journey.

Ingredients

20min
4 servings
  1. As required Red, green capsicums
  2. as requiredBroccoli
  3. 1/2 cupGrated paneer
  4. as neededOlive oil
  5. 1 tspblack pepper powder
  6. 1/4 tspred chili flakes
  7. as requiredItalian seasoning/pizza seasoning

Cooking Instructions

20min
  1. 1

    Wash and Cut broccoli florets. In a bowl add broccoli, olive oil, salt, red chili 🌶 flakes, and black pepper powder. Mix nicely and keep it for 10min aside. Grate paneer, add Italian seasoning salt and black pepper powder. Add yellow chili chopped. Mix.

  2. 2

    Cut capsicum in a round shape.put it a baking tray drizzle few drops of olive oil. Fill the capsicum rings with paneer and bake it in preheated oven for15min.

  3. 3

    Once capsicums are done bake broccoli for 15-20min. If florets are little bit hard, it will take 5min extra in cooking.Baked capsicum with paneer and broccoli is ready to serve.
